>>44378251
My old compressor didn't have one. A tank is a strong want for a couple of reasons, though:
- Compressor longetivity. Without one, it's running all the time (and wearing itself out while it does so). With one, the conpressor gets a chance to cool off while you work.
- Air pulse. Not something I've encountered, but some people say they have problems with the pulse of the compressor running interference with their spray. The tank acts as a baffle between the compressor and the output (no chance of pulsing).

>44384491
I use Vallejo for most colours and Citadel for metallics and their technical line. Citadel also has a larger range of washes and glazes.

Citadel base paints correspond with Vallejo 'Heavy' paints. There's a good guide on Dakka Dakka that shows which VMC and VGC paints match with which Citadel paints and it's fairly on target. I don't think the blues quite match.

Vallejo has dropper bottles, which I prefer since there is zero chance of cross-contamination and it's harder to not close the cap properly like with Citadel. (Seriously, people keep forgetting to close the back half of their Citadel paint pots.)

I think if you're basing in a colour you could do worse than investing in a Citadel or Army Painter spray primer + base. I use Daemonic Yellow to prime my Imperial Fists and it's a decent time saver and near-guarantees me a smooth base coat.
>>
>>44384720
I meant to add that if you're priming in White, Black, or Gray save yourself some money and get normie spray paint from your local hardware store. Krylon and Rustoleum make decent stuff. If you need a colour like Green, Yellow, Silver, etc. you might need to go with a hobby spray paint.

>>44386936
from 2 30k threads ago:
Why guess, when FW answers.
Challenge mode on: FW did not say which clear red, so assume it's Tamiya as usual, or their own Angron clear red.

>Metallic Scheme:

>It is black undercoat, airbrush with Iron hands FW paint leaving the lower parts of the armour plates black, airbrush upper parts of the armour plates with runefang steel as a highlight.

>Then a few thinned layers of clear red are airbrushed all over, waiting for the previous layer to dry before applying the next (so it would be useful to paint large batches of marines at the same time).

>Shade the recesses with nuln oil and then weather the edges with runefang steel.

>The gold is retributor gold, shaded with seraphim sepia and highlighted with runefang steel.

>The brass is runelord brass, shaded with seraphim sepia.

>The eyes are painted black, single line in the centre with white and then washed with FW clear green paint.

>The white on the bolters and legion icon is celestra grey, ulthuan grey and then white highlights. The hollow tactical arrow is from the Iron Warriors transfer sheet.

>>44378503
>>44378251
Claiming that you HAVE to have a tank is a massive overstatement. If you're airbrushing a harley or basecoating 300 space marines in one sitting, then yes, you'll want one, but for 99% of what the average warhammer hobbyist uses it for, you really don't need one.

I have a nice compressor with a pretty large tank in the garage hobby area, and I still end up using my tiny tiny iwata neo air most of the time, which is a tiny tankless desktop compressor and not much different from the small, cute compressors that they sell for nail or cake decoration and face painting. I can use it for about 30 minutes before giving it a rest for 30 minutes or so, and in that time I can pretty much paint my entire desk Goblin Green if I wanted to, so as long as you're efficient and not sitting around thinking of what to paint with the airbrush in your hand and the compressor running, you're good.

The correct answer is "whatever works for you, anon" and in this case, it's very individual. If you're going to slap some coats of paint on a few space marines or a dragon, the tank is not needed. Just keep in mind that tankless compressors make more noise since they have to work whenever you use up air to keep up pressure (so they make noise while you use them, not a lot though), and that you'll wear them out if you leave them on for too long without resting.
